Listening ability is one of the basic skills that must be mastered by elementary school students in learning Indonesian. However, in reality, students' listening ability is still relatively low. This article aims to examine various learning strategies and media used to improve elementary school students' listening skills through literature studies. The research method used is a qualitative approach with a literature review from various scientific sources. The results of the study show that learning media such as storytelling pictures, digital storytelling, wayang cerita and audio-visual media can significantly increase students' interest, understanding, and active participation in listening activities. The application of appropriate and innovative media has a positive impact on improving listening skills and supporting the achievement of Indonesian language learning objectives at the elementary level.
